引言
随着互联网和移动设备的普及,用户界面(UI)设计的重要性日益凸显。优秀的UI设计不仅能提升用户体验,还能增强产品的市场竞争力。本文将深入探讨UI设计的精髓,从入门到精通,帮助读者全面提升界面设计能力。
第一章:UI设计基础
1.1 UI设计的定义
UI设计是指用户界面设计,它关注的是软件或产品与用户之间的交互界面。一个成功的UI设计应具备易用性、美观性和功能性。
1.2 UI设计的原则
- 一致性:界面元素的风格、布局和交互方式应保持一致。
- 简洁性:界面应简洁明了,避免冗余信息。
- 易用性:界面应易于操作,减少用户的认知负担。
- 美观性:界面设计应美观大方,符合用户审美。
1.3 UI设计工具
- Sketch:一款流行的矢量图形设计工具,适用于Mac系统。
- Adobe XD:一款适用于网页和移动应用的界面设计工具。
- Figma:一款在线协作设计工具,支持多人实时协作。
第二章:UI设计流程
2.1 需求分析
在开始设计之前,首先要明确设计的目标和用户需求。可以通过问卷调查、用户访谈等方式收集信息。
2.2 竞品分析
分析竞品的设计,了解行业趋势和用户喜好,为自身设计提供参考。
2.3 原型设计
使用原型设计工具制作界面原型,验证设计的可行性和易用性。
2.4 高保真设计
在原型基础上,进行高保真设计,包括细节调整和视觉优化。
2.5 交互设计
设计界面元素的交互方式,确保用户能够顺畅地使用产品。
第三章:UI设计技巧
3.1 色彩搭配
- 色彩理论:了解色彩的基本知识,如色轮、色彩对比等。
- 色彩心理学:根据不同场景选择合适的色彩,如蓝色代表信任、绿色代表自然等。
3.2 字体选择
- 字体类型:根据界面风格选择合适的字体类型,如衬线字体适合正式场合,无衬线字体适合现代风格。
- 字体大小:确保字体大小适中,便于阅读。
3.3 空间布局
- 网格系统:使用网格系统进行界面布局,使界面更加有序。
- 对齐方式:保持界面元素对齐,提升视觉一致性。
3.4 交互效果
- 动画效果:合理运用动画效果,提升用户体验。
- 反馈机制:设计清晰的反馈机制,让用户了解操作结果。
第四章:实战案例
4.1 案例一:社交媒体应用
- 需求分析:分析用户在社交媒体上的需求,如发布动态、浏览内容等。
- 设计过程:从原型设计到高保真设计,逐步完善界面。
- 优化建议:根据用户反馈进行优化,提升产品易用性。
4.2 案例二:电商平台
- 需求分析:分析用户在电商平台上的购物需求,如浏览商品、下单支付等。
- 设计过程:从原型设计到高保真设计,逐步完善界面。
- 优化建议:优化购物流程,提升用户体验。
第五章:UI设计发展趋势
5.1 响应式设计
随着移动设备的普及,响应式设计成为UI设计的重要趋势。设计应适应不同尺寸和分辨率的设备。
5.2 个性化设计
根据用户喜好和需求,提供个性化的界面设计。
5.3 人工智能与UI设计
人工智能技术逐渐应用于UI设计,如智能推荐、语音交互等。
结语
UI设计是一门综合性学科,需要不断学习和实践。通过本文的介绍,相信读者已经对UI设计有了更深入的了解。希望读者能够在实践中不断提升自己的设计能力,为用户提供更好的产品体验。
